These baths, often referred to as plastic baths, are manufactured using molded acrylic sheets. This allows them to be available in various sizes and shapes while remaining more affordable and lightweight than steel baths. However, they are not as durable as metal baths and can be prone to scratches, chips, cracks, and dents. Believe it or not, there are countless shades of white used in baths and shower trays! Different manufacturers use varying shades of white, which is why colour matching is so important. Achieving a perfect colour match is a crucial step in any bath repair. Our technicians are experts in colour matching, having honed their skills over years of experience. Because bath surfaces can fade or change over time, an exact colour match requires expert mixing. Our technicians will create a unique colour for your repair using special tinters.
We source the highest quality materials to ensure a long-lasting and professional-grade repair. Most DIY kits only include one or two shades of white, which rarely match the actual bath colour. First, our expert technician fills the damaged spot and applies a bonder for strong adhesion. Next, the technician precisely colour-matches the enamel using tinting techniques and applies it with a fine spray gun. Using expert judgment and advanced techniques, we achieve a seamless, invisible blend.
